Symphony Environmental Technologies plc
("Symphony" or the "Company")
Appointment of non-executive director and grant of options
Symphony Environmental Technologies plc (AIM: SYM), global specialists in
technologies that make plastic and rubber products smarter, safer and more
sustainable, is pleased to announce that Michael Kayser has been appointed as
an independent non-executive director of the Company with immediate effect.
Michael is an experienced finance professional with more than 40 years'
experience across a variety of roles in both UK and with international
organisations. During the last 10 years he has primarily provided
non-executive director services to organisations including the Transport
Research Foundation, Biome Technologies Plc, the Transport Systems Catapult
and Stobart Group Limited. Prior to this, Michael also worked for Accenture,
Guinness (worldwide Finance Director for its beer division), HSBC, Laporte plc
(Finance Director), Lloyds Register (CFO and Chief Operating Officer), Royal
Bank of Scotland (private equity) and Unilever.

Options
The Company has granted options to Michael Kayser over 150,000 ordinary shares
of Symphony ("Options"). The Options are exercisable at a price of 4.5 pence
per ordinary share, being 20% higher than the closing share price on the day
immediately preceding the date of grant of the Options. The Options vest after
six months from the date of grant and expire on the third anniversary of the
date of grant.
